  What is a Bitcoin Price Stock Symbol?

  A Bitcoin price stock symbol is a unique identifier used to represent Bitcoin's value in the financial markets. Similar to traditional stocks, Bitcoin is traded on various exchanges, and its price is constantly fluctuating. The stock symbol serves as a shorthand for investors to quickly identify and track Bitcoin's performance.

  The Most Common Bitcoin Price Stock Symbol

  The most widely recognized Bitcoin price stock symbol is BTC/USD, which represents the price of Bitcoin in U.S. dollars. This symbol is used across various financial platforms, including stock exchanges, cryptocurrency exchanges, and financial news websites. BTC/USD is the most popular and widely followed Bitcoin price stock symbol due to its simplicity and global recognition.

  Other Bitcoin Price Stock Symbols

  While BTC/USD is the most common Bitcoin price stock symbol, there are other symbols used to represent Bitcoin's value in different currencies. Some of these symbols include:

  1. BTC/EUR: Represents the price of Bitcoin in euros.

  2. BTC/JPY: Represents the price of Bitcoin in Japanese yen.

  3. BTC/CAD: Represents the price of Bitcoin in Canadian dollars.
